General Plan Meet at boat ramp at centre of St Heliers beach at 8.30am for 9.00am departure. ( This is the first day back on standard time so it will not feel like an early start!)
Paddle around the corner into the Tamaki estuary with the incoming tide. Explore the coastline, see how far we can get (dependant on the abilities of the group). Return after a lunch break back to St Heliers. Back around 3 – 4pm.
